GOOD GRIEF II is the best of the best. The boat was originally carefully detailed for a 3 time Grand Banks owner. She was factory ordered with teak and holly cabin soles, a combination washer / dryer, an "L galley" with overhead dish storage, and an island queen berth aft with desk and the split head / shower stall. At the time, Grand Banks also revised the standard flybridge layout, supplying this boat with twin, independent helmsman's seats, the flybridge L settee, table and opposing settee. She was additionally carefully outfitted, thoroughly commissioned and happily used for all of one season. Her owner's change of plans provides a unique opportunity for one lucky individual to have one of the very last, updated, famed Grand Banks 42 Classics. |
